Obama's Former Advisor Apologises After Video Of Racist Rant Goes Viral

The viral video shows Stuart Seldowitz asking the food vendor racist and Islamophobic questions.

A former US State Department employee and national security official, identified as Stuart Seldowitz, was captured on video engaging in harassment of a halal food vendor in Manhattan. In a brief exchange about child casualties, Seldowitz callously remarks, "If we killed 4,000 Palestinian kids, you know what? It wasn't enough."

There are a series of disturbing videos online where Seldowitz is seen hurling a barrage of anti-Palestine comments and insults at the unidentified vendor. One video shows Seldowitz accosting the vendor, calling him a "terrorist" and making inflammatory remarks about the Israel-Hamas conflict.
